Kenya certifies first privately run warehouse

Afex Fair Trade, Kenya, a farmer service company in Kenya has received a certification for one of its warehouses as a warehouse receipt operator.

The Warehouse Receipt System Council (WRSC) at the Soy Mateeny warehouse in Uasin Gishu County did the certification, marking the first time that a warehouse receipt operator license has been issued to a private sector company.
